A Union Perspective
Guest User Guest User

A Union Perspective

Unionizing Alberta social workers will yield significant benefits, particularly in terms of addressing job-related stress, improving working conditions, ensuring fair compensation. A union could advocate for manageable caseloads, mental health support, and professional development opportunities, enhancing job satisfaction and retention.

Paid vs. Unpaid Practicums
Guest User Guest User

Paid vs. Unpaid Practicums

The issue of whether practicums should be compensated remains contentious. This report examines the current cost of living crisis in Canada, the hidden costs of practicums, the conflicts that unpaid practicums have with the CASW code of ethics, and a recommendation for a federally paid practicum program for Canada's social work and public service students.

Brain Story Certification
Guest User Guest User

Brain Story Certification

Brain Story emphasizes supporting children and families throughout all stages of development, including prenatal development. It explains how early childhood trauma and toxic stress affect neural connections and lifelong health, leading to issues such as emotional dysregulation, depression, anxiety, impaired executive function, chronic illness, and addiction.

What is Social Work?
Guest User Guest User

What is Social Work?

Social work is a regulated profession committed to making society more equitable and inclusive. Social work is dedicated to improving the functioning of individuals, families, and communities. Social workers can work in a variety of settings such as healthcare, education, child welfare, public policy, non-profits, and the judicial system.
